A cellular model of swarm intelligence in bees and robots

We present here a simple cellular model of random motion and social interaction of young honeybees making swarm intelligent decisions in complex dynamic temperature fields. We model also behaviors of stationary robots that affect those bees. Our study looks for a first as-simple-as-possible approach towards modeling such a bio-hybrid system. Our model predicts observed collective behaviors qualitatively very well by modeling a correlated random walk and a simple social interaction mechanism. We found that even a very simple 2-dimensional cellular model with a limited state space of 16 bit per cell suffices. Ultimately, the simplicity of the model allows fast and distributed computation. This will allow us to search for interesting swarm intelligent robotic algorithms for creating novel bio-hybrid systems composed by real animals and autonomous rule-driven cellular robots by using stochastic optimization techniques. CCS Concepts •General and reference → General conference proceedings; •Computing methodologies → Multi-agent systems; Artificial life; Mobile agents; Agent / discrete models; Cooperation and coordination;

[1]  Thomas Schmickl,et al.  Embodiment of Honeybee's Thermotaxis in a Mobile Robot Swarm , 2009, ECAL.

[2]  Marco Dorigo,et al.  Swarm intelligence: from natural to artificial systems , 1999 .

[3]  D S Broomhead,et al.  Shape and dynamics of thermoregulating honey bee clusters. , 2000, Journal of theoretical biology.

[4]  Thomas Schmickl,et al.  Coordination of collective behaviours in spatially separated agents , 2015, ECAL.

[5]  Thomas Schmickl,et al.  Interaction of robot swarms using the honeybee-inspired control algorithm BEECLUST , 2012 .

[6]  Thomas Schmickl,et al.  Influence of a Social Gradient on a Swarm of Agents Controlled by the BEECLUST Algorithm , 2013, ECAL.

[7]  Thomas Schmickl,et al.  The efficiency of the RULES-4 classification learning algorithm in predicting the density of agents , 2014 .

[8]  J. Boomsma,et al.  Task partitioning in insect societies: bucket brigades , 2002, Insectes Sociaux.

[9]  John H. Holland,et al.  Adaptation in Natural and Artificial Systems: An Introductory Analysis with Applications to Biology, Control, and Artificial Intelligence , 1992 .

[10]  John R. Koza,et al.  Genetic programming - on the programming of computers by means of natural selection , 1993, Complex adaptive systems.

[11]  Geoffrey R. Williams,et al.  An update on the COLOSS network and the “BEEBOOK: standard methodologies for Apis mellifera research” , 2012 .

[12]  James P. Crutchfield,et al.  Revisiting the Edge of Chaos: Evolving Cellular Automata to Perform Computations , 1993, Complex Syst..

[13]  S. Kauffman Emergent properties in random complex automata , 1984 .

[14]  H. Heller,et al.  Colonial thermoregulation in honey bees (Apis mellifera) , 1982, Journal of comparative physiology.

[15]  Herbert Heran,et al.  Untersuchungen über den Temperatursinn der Honigbiene (Apis mellifica) unter besonderer Berücksichtigung der Wahrnehmung strahlender Wärme , 1952, Zeitschrift für vergleichende Physiologie.

[16]  Serge Kernbach,et al.  Re-embodiment of Honeybee Aggregation Behavior in an Artificial Micro-Robotic System , 2009, Adapt. Behav..

[17]  Thomas Schmickl,et al.  Potential of Heterogeneity in Collective Behaviors: A Case Study on Heterogeneous Swarms , 2015, PRIMA.

[18]  Mauro Birattari,et al.  Swarm Intelligence , 2012, Lecture Notes in Computer Science.

[19]  Serge Kernbach,et al.  Get in touch: cooperative decision making based on robot-to-robot collisions , 2009, Autonomous Agents and Multi-Agent Systems.

[20]  Thomas Schmickl,et al.  Beeclust: A Swarm Algorithm Derived from Honeybees Derivation of the Algorithm, Analysis by Mathematical Models and Implementation on a Robot Swarm , 2011 .

[21]  F. S. Bodenheimer Studies in Animal Populations. II. Seasonal Population-Trends of the Honey-Bee , 1937, The Quarterly Review of Biology.

[22]  Edward A. Codling,et al.  Random walk models in biology , 2008, Journal of The Royal Society Interface.

[23]  Ingo Rechenberg,et al.  Evolutionsstrategie : Optimierung technischer Systeme nach Prinzipien der biologischen Evolution , 1973 .

[24]  Thomas Schmickl,et al.  Dynamics of Collective Decision Making of Honeybees in Complex Temperature Fields , 2013, PloS one.